http://www.moray.gov.uk/downloads/file70312.pdf WitrynaBuilding the Curriculum 3: A framework for learning and teaching. Building the Curriculum 3 (2008) is the framework for planning a curriculum which meets the needs of all children and young people from 3 to 18. ... (2011) provides guidance on the main areas of the assessment strategy for Curriculum for Excellence. PDF file: Building …

Curriculum for Excellence places learners at the heart of education. At its centre are four fundamental capacities. These capacities reflect and recognise the lifelong nature of education and learning. The four capacities are aimed at helping children and young people to become: 1.
